Transaction dfafa2113f7e943e81491f75420680e62889235304c82169b590d10734bb3d39
4 Input
2 Outputs
- dfafa2113f7e943e81491f75420680e62889235304c82169b590d10734bb3d39:0
- dfafa2113f7e943e81491f75420680e62889235304c82169b590d10734bb3d39:1
value 176200000
address 16PMPP3DSQAwTFeN72oiiYf5xSpPQsW5c2
value 61133214
address 12fBx3Z5fZToCkMtwaAvynrzWSGXPJchxT